"Catching Crooks"

     The Fayetteville Police Department is still looking for a man who has robbed three local banks. In the month of June, he hit two Arvest Branches in Fayetteville and struck again in July at the First National Bank on Rogers Avenue in Fort Smith. Police say he has not used a gun but instead passes a note to bank tellers which demands money.
     The suspect is described as a heavyset male that stands about 5-feet-8 inches tall. At the time of the robberies, he had facial hair and was wearing a baseball cap. It's unknown if this suspect is responsible for Northwest Arkansas' latest bank robbery that happened Thursday in Springdale.
